Why do these people even think these billionaires have all these billions in their account? Do they even understand the concept of net worth? That Bill Gates is worth $100 billion does not mean that he has $100 billion in his account. Most of his wealth is tied up in stocks. Your net worth is far more than the N500,000 in your account. It consists of your cars, your investments, your houses, your convertible skills, your stocks, your 401k, your retirement funds etc. If you're a musician, your music catalogue and popularity will make up the bulk of your net worth. You can have a net worth of $50 million and not have a single dime in your bank accounts. You might even be in severe debt. So, how do you redistribute net worth to others? |
